[WP] After no contact from outer space, NASA finally receives an Alien radio signal with only 7 words: "The birds are not what they seem"

“The birds are not what they seem….The birds are not what they seem… WTF spacemen. Way to be vague. How is that helpful?” She mumbles as she walks home from the grocery store. How could they expect that she and her colleagues were going to figure it out? It wasn’t rocket science…and that was the problem. They were out of their element. “Oh, well. Some other government agency can figure it out.” She eyes the seagulls feasting and fighting over french fries served a la sidewalk while she walks tentatively, trying to both avoid them and keep the peaches from getting swished. The fruit somehow ended up in the bottom of the bag since she left the store. When she tried to adjust, things had begun escaping from their tetris-like arrangement. The nearby ravens had quickly moved expectantly towards her when the cracker box busted open, dumping half of itself into the dirt. “Smart little creatures. They’ll probably all go tell their friends to follow me around. I drop food.” She concentrated. The ravens yelled overhead.

With everything safely stored, she curls up in front of her MacBook. Compelled by the feeling that she already knew the answer, she opens a new tab and starts to type in search terms. “Birds.” Her fingertips balance on the keys. “What am I even looking for?” Slumped in her chair, pushing urgency out of the way, she decides a distraction is in order. Her favorite websites which were now intent on covering only the actions of one now very powerful man. He was inescapable.

“That’s new” she thought, catching a title about yet another mandate. “How did I not hear about that?” One commenter suggested that the man everyone was watching was making an unprecedented number of simultaneous sweeping changes so no one could keep up. “To distract people!” the user declared. She asks the screen “Distract us from what?”

There are a few political cartoons embedded in the chaotic news and she pauses at one were the now very powerful man in charge is shouting. Twitter logos were floating in the place of words. She laughed. His obsessive need to express himself via the little blue bird was a popular target of ridicule.

Her smile turns to terror. She bolts upright, spilling tea in to the carpet. “Oh, s**t. They weren’t talking about the animals.”
